I must say these 2 References are quite similar with subtle differences that, for me, I have to look more than twice to distinguish them.


5040P, apparently only about 30 pieces made, sports Arabic numerals unlike 5040WG, 5040J and 5040R which has Breguet numerals.  35 mm Tonneau shaped case is a good size with bombe bezel.


But I’m quite surprised to learn that 5041G is even more rare, around 250 pieces made (according to auction house sources)! I believe it has thicker but flat bezel with smaller crown? Outer minutes ring is dotted as supposed to 5040 railroad track.


Do you PuristS know whether the 5041G is in fact more rare than 5040P ?  What are your thoughts on these two references?
